  • The TuMIC project
    The TuMIC project is using novel experimental approaches to integrate newly emerging principles and ideas concerning tumor dissemination with the different hypotheses that have until now tried to explain the process of metastasis. Specifically it aims to understand how cancer stem cells behave in and contribute to metastasis, and how networks and pathways that are known to regulate metastasis affect their properties. Further objectives are to determine how a permissive microenvironment for metastasis formation is established in given organs, how this contributes to determining patterns of metastasis, and how these microenvironments interact with cancer stem cells.

  • The SFMET project
    The SFMET project aims to clarify the way in which hypoxia or the Wnt and chemokine pathways affect Met-dependent tumour progression and develop novel therapeutics targeting Met or selected downstream effectors for the therapy of metastatic cancer.

  • The Champalimaud Foundation
    The Champalimaud Foundation is a private organisation dedicated to making advances in biomedical science. With an endowment of 500,000,000 Euros, the Foundation’s work is focused on three core areas – neuroscience research, cancer research, and an outreach programme to support the fight against blindness. Based in Lisbon, Portugal, the Foundation is in the process of constructing the Champalimaud Centre for the Unknown, a cutting-edge research facility that, by 2010, will host the majority of the Foundation’s research activities.
